Don't weigh yourself so often. Everything in you has weight and almost all of the changes you see within the week are not fat gain/loss. A 16 oz bottle of water is a little over a pound. Your weight can also be influenced by your cycle. The difference between one day and the next is absolutely meaningless.
Frequent weighing is better for your intake. Measure/weigh everything. Nutrition labels may say 2 of something is a serving size but unless the two you pick weigh exactly as much as they should, your calories will be incorrect. Same with peanut butter, salad dressings, and any non-liquid you measure in a measuring spoon or cup, grams are king. If you cook with any kind of oil, you have to record that too.0 -

All scales are inaccurate to a degree, which is why the number you see on any given day (or at any given moment in your case) doesn't matter all that much. The fact that it's normal for our weight to fluctuate from one day to the next also plays into this. What does matter is how those numbers on the scale move over time.
Comparing one weigh in to the next is a pretty useless exercise. It's much more informative to compare the trend of your weigh-ins from one month to the next.2 -
